As a chemical intermediate, Sodium 1-octanesulfonate Monohydrate offers a unique combination of an alkyl chain and a sulfonate group, making it valuable for introducing specific functionalities or modifying molecular properties. While its primary renown comes from its application as an ion-pairing reagent in chromatography, its role in synthesis should not be overlooked. The compound's structure allows it to participate in or facilitate reactions where its surfactant properties or its ability to act as a counter-ion can be leveraged.
